Dawn, reeling from the death of their partner, spirals into isolation and makes a deal with fate. Hidden in the sounds of the city, Dawn refuses to fulfill their deal resulting in three strangers arriving on their door step. Split between, longing for the past, avoiding the present, and intimidated by the future, Dawn must unravel the mess to restore order.
Fate Train, weaves Norse Gods and the modern day into a surreal tale where time, memory and self become blurred. Powerfully poetic, and unflinchingly human, it explores the myths we cling to when everything feels like it’s falling apart. Both intimate and epic, it invites audiences into a world where the divine and the human collide and asks who are we without the ones we have lost?
